Explanation:
The common asexual method of reproduction by hydras is budding. Buds originate at the junction of the stalk and gastric regions. The bud begins as a hemispherical outpouching that eventually elongates, becomes cylindrical, and develops tentacles. The bud then pinches off and a new individual becomes independent. Buds are produced every two to three days under favorable conditions. Following unfavorable conditions, such as injuries or periods of scarce resources, hydras occasionally reproduce through transverse and longitudinal fission.

explain how pH and temperature can affect enzyme activity
Please help has to be due in 20 mins. Thank you for helping me.
Answer:
Enzyme activity depends on many factors such as Substrate concentration, enzyme cofactor, enzyme inhibitors, pH, and temperature. pH and temperature are two important factors that directly affect the activity of an enzyme as follows:
1. pH
Each enzyme has the specific optimal pH that allows it to perform its function to its fullest. The enzymes are the protein made up of the interaction of the hydrogen bond in the side chain of the protein. if there is any change from optimum pH, the enzyme activity decreases until it stops working.
2. Temperature:
Each enzyme has its own optimal temperature. Any modification or change in temperature results in the activity of an enzyme, and it also leads to the denaturation of an enzyme as it is made up of protein.

From the bacterial model:
(a) the tail-like structure is known as the flagellum (plural, flagella)
(b) The primary function of the structure is to aid movement. It is moved in a whip-like version to propel the organism.
(c) Based on the absence of of flagellum in the other two bacteria, it means that they are not motile.
The presence of flagellum in bacteria is an indication that such bacteria are motile. The thread-like structure is whipped randomly in order for the organism to move and the absence of it in an bacterium is an indication that such a bacterium is not motile.

what is the central feature of the cell cycle
Answer:
The central components of the cell-cycle control system are cyclin-dependent protein kinases (Cdks), whose activity depends on association with regulatory subunits called cyclins. Oscillations in the activities of various cyclin-Cdk complexes leads to the initiation of various cell-cycle events.
